Tatsuo is a makeup artist for a fashion photographer and is sick and tired of the models fawning over the new hairstylist, Haga. One morning, he comes across one of the models running out of Haga's room with tears in her eyes and has a long talk with him about how rude and antisocial he is. That's when Tatsuo realizes, Haga doesn't really know how to treat others and doesn't even have a single friend - until now?
Kang Hyeon Ho, who belongs in the university soccer team goes into a breadth class and encounters the person he went to middle school together with and was his first love, Han Gyeol. To avoid the regret of not properly conveying his feelings again, Kang Hyeon Ho approaches Han Gyeol, but after losing his parents and left in a relative's house with a younger brother, he works hard in part time job and doesn't give his heart easily.

This series follows the life of Sumito Kayashima. Sumito is a spoiled, wealthy yet lazy young man. Sumito doesn't work. He spends his days going to parties and frivilously spending away his wealth on antiques, books he doesn't intend to read, and other such things. His daily routine and interests are managed by his hired conversationalist/secretary Koizumi.

The novelist Sakaguchi was troubled. When Sakaguchi took in a weak kitten, the high schooler Kazuya, who comes to the his house to visit the cat, suddenly confessed. He thought it was just childish nonsense, but while usually being quiet, the Kazuya who is confesed his love awkwardly while his ears became red, seemed cute to Sakaguchi. But... adult love also entails sex, right?
Haru has been in love with Soudai, his elder brother’s best friend, since he was a child. More than his brother, Haru chases after Soudai and even gets into the same club as him. He can’t be with him all the time, and if Soudai doesn’t look at him, he will feel worried but he can’t be honest at all.
Enjouji Takumi is a rickshaw driver from the city that has been hired to work in a small town. Meeting the exquisitely beautiful (but rather clueless) Hana is a stroke of luck, and when he ends up working with Hana, Takumi's in heaven. But the "flower of the town" has many admirers...
